"My treasure" in Chinese can be translated as "我的宝贝" (wǒ de bǎobèi). "我" (wǒ) means "my," and "宝贝" (bǎobèi) means "treasure" or "treasured item." This phrase is often used affectionately to refer to someone dear to you.
